The 14th Annual Summer Institute for Climate Change Education will be in Washington D.C., co-hosted by the Lowell School, and with support from the NOAA Climate Office.
Join a network of teachers from across the country dedicated to bringing climate change education into Humanities classrooms! Content will be focused on grades 6-12 teachers in social studies/ELA/political science/environmental studies subjects.
Highlights include:
- New resources– including Climate Generation humanities curriculum and book guides
- Participate in the World Climate Simulation
- Field trip around Washington D.C. featuring sites in their climate action plan
- Climate change trivia night at a local brewery
